Balancing skills and theory, "Principles of Public Speaking" emphasizes orality, Internet technology, and critical thinking as it encourages students to see public speaking as a way to build community in today's diverse world. Within a framework that emphasizes speaker responsibility, critical thinking and listening, and cultural awareness, this classic text uses examples from college, workplace, political, and social communication to make the study of public speaking relevant, contemporary, and exciting for students. This brief but comprehensive text also offers students the latest in using technology in speechmaking, featuring a unique and exciting integrated text and technology learning system. New to the Sixteenth Edition New easy-to-find section on web resources. This extensive coverage of how to use and evaluate electronic sources keeps students up-to-date on the latest information about using technology effectively for research. Now includes an extensive discussion on using PowerPoint slides. This new coverage discusses how to design exciting, eye-catching slides and strategies for incorporating them seamlessly into a presentation. Contains updated examples throughout, including those that reflect greater cultural diversity, changes in technology, and the latest research in public speaking. New Chapter (Ch. 16) discusses group-based speeches, including team presentations and responding to questions and objections.
